Despite making the Tour his primary focus for 2018, the Colombian hasn’t looked the rider he once was

Quintana Goes Awol

 

Prior to the start of stage 15 in Millau, Sky DS Nicolas Portal was asked for his opinion on the team’s 21-year-old Colombian Egan Bernal, and particularly his hugely impressive performance on Alpe d’Huez, where he set the pace for Geraint Thomas and Chris Froome for seven kilometres. Having outlined Bernal’s many qualities, Portal pointed out that many Colombian riders have shown immense potential when they first emerge, but most fail to deliver on it. “I believe Egan is the real deal, though,” he stated.
